The article was written by Dawn Stover, In January 2001. The tile of this article is called Ancient Asteroid. I found this article at http://popsci.com/scitech/news/010219.s.html. This article is about How Astronomers had thought that the asteroid 433 Eros might have been a flying pile of rubble, but now after looking over the images and the millions of measurements taken by the earth Astroid near the shoemaker spacecraft the scientist say that Eros is a "consolidated" asteroid, witch is a solid object. However Eros never separated to the distinct crust, mantle, nor core. Cause of the low level on the aluminum detected on Eros, The scientist at John Hopkins University Appiled Physics Laboratory said that the Astroid did not experience anything like the melting process of the earth's shape. An Eros are about the size of Manhattan and the shape is like a peanut. If it was as large as the earth It most likely not keep it's shape. Since the Eros have less gravity than earth, A person would weigh about 150 pounds here and would way about one or two bags of airline peanuts. Background of ASOS Company Two people namely Nick and Quentin founded ASOS in June 2000 in the United Kingdom. The acronym refers to â€Å"as seen on screen†. The company started as a small business that specialized on online sales of products that were associated with celebrities. ASOS has about 1000 employees and approximately 50,000 brands on fashion. Within one year after the Company was created, it joined London Stock Exchange and continued growing in size. ASOS has developed strategies to attract attention from women from the year 2005 by introducing a beauty line and men’s line in the year 2007. Today, the company is the leading retailer in the United Kingdom (Brynjolfsson Smith 2001).
